Lillian Bassman leveraged the seismic cultural shifts of postwar America in her ingenious blend of illustration and photography. Marrying form and motion, she utilized darkroom techniques like polarization along with inventive manipulations using materials such as bleach and smoke in her linear, ethereal images.
